Car insurance is a crucial aspect of owning a vehicle in today’s world. It provides financial protection in case of accidents, theft, or other incidents that can damage your vehicle or cause harm to others. However, for some individuals, obtaining car insurance without a social security number can be a challenging task. Whether you are a new immigrant, a student, or simply someone who does not have a social security number, it is still possible to get car insurance coverage. Concerns and Answers:

1. Can I get car insurance without a social security number?

“Yes, you can still get car insurance without a social security number. Some insurance companies offer options for individuals who do not have a social security number. You may need to provide an Individual Taxpayer Identification Number (ITIN) or other forms of identification.”

2. Will not having a social security number affect my insurance premium?

“Not necessarily. Your insurance premium is determined by various factors such as your driving record, vehicle type, location, and coverage options. Not having a social security number may not have a significant impact on your premium.”

3. What documents do I need to provide to get car insurance without a social security number?

“You may need to provide alternative forms of identification such as a passport, driver’s license from your home country, or an ITIN. Each insurance company may have different requirements, so it’s best to contact them directly.”

4. Can I get full coverage car insurance without a social security number?

“Yes, you can still get full coverage car insurance without a social security number. However, the availability of certain coverage options may vary depending on the insurance company and state regulations.”
